16 Treehouse Airbnbs Fit For Magical Fall Getaways

There’s something about a treehouse that just feels like magic. Whether you're resting beneath colorful autumn leaves, cozied up amidst snowy branches, or exploring the terrain on sunny summer days, these whimsical perches tangled in branches remind us of childhood adventures. As adults, revisiting one of these nostalgic structures no longer has to involve rope ladders or tree climbing. Thanks to Airbnb, there is a myriad of unique and comfortable treehouses available to book now.

With Airbnb's arboreal offerings, your treehouse dreams can become vacation realities. The home-stay site curates some of its most popular treehouse rentals across the globe, but we’ve also gone ahead and taken an extra close look at what’s out there. And trust us, you can do way more than host a stuffed animal tea party in the stunning structures ahead — they’re designed for eating, sleeping, and enjoying outdoor seclusion with friends.

From rustic structures to luxury glamping, the 16 sublime treehouses ahead are brimming with all the nostalgic dreams of childhood and the creature comforts of our adult lives.

Conway, New Hampshire


Location: North Conway, NH
Sleeps: 3 (1 bedroom, 1 bed, 0 baths)
Price Per Night: $132

The Space: You've officially been warned: this one-bedroom, ZERO bath (there is, in fact, a "humanure" outhouse) treehouse is as "rustic" as things get. And yet Airbnb reviewers can't seem to get enough. Unplug, reset, and revel in the authenticity of this quaint, pet-friendly listing equipped with bedding, outdoor kitchen, cooking essentials, gallons of water, and more bare necessities.

Rating: 4.95 out of 5 stars and 490 reviews

Reviewers Say: "This was our second time staying at the treehouse. We love it so much! There are great trails in the woods and hiking right in the back yard. It is a very peaceful place in both the day and night and is the perfect escape." —Courtney, Airbnb Reviewer (February 2022); "The bed was comfortable and we stayed warm, even when we turned the heater off for the night. The outhouse and composting toilet which uses sawdust was clean and tidy and only a few steps away from the treehouse. We cooked indoors but washing the dishes in the outdoor kitchen was close and easy. The rustic nature of the facilities was exactly what we were looking for and we were able to unplug for the weekend and enjoy being in nature." —Elizabeth, Airbnb Reviewer (February 2022)
